Quick briefing ahead of Thursday's leadership review. We're asking for a 12% uplift to the Kestrel Line refurbishment budget — mostly to cover the new fit-out at the Marwick branch and tooling for the Oakhollow depot. Yes, it's more than we flagged in spring, but the quotes from Bramleigh Contracting came in high across the board. Dena Holt has the full breakdown if you want numbers. The rationale ties directly into where we're heading next year.

board note of kagep-yahig: Only 9 of the 120 pilot accounts renewed Quenix, so a churn review is set for April 1.

Step 4 — Payroll export cutover (Ledgerline v9)

Stop the export workers. Swap EXPORT_FORMAT from fixed-width to the new delimited spec; downstream at Brindlehook Accounting has already switched parsers. Bump SCHEMA_VERSION to 9. Do not restart until the env file is finalized — the transfer job will fail silently otherwise. The token the uploader uses to reach the Brindlehook drop endpoint sits on the next line.

secret setting of baduf-fahag: LEDGER_TOKEN8=35e35511

**Action Item 4: Tighten gateway rate limits**

During the Octavine incident, the Kestrel gateway allowed burst traffic well beyond the documented quota because per-tenant buckets were misconfigured. Owner: the platform rotation. Please review each tenant tier carefully before changing limits, as some batch jobs legitimately spike. The current limit matrix is maintained on the internal page below.

operations page: https://jira.qorvelsys.internal/browse/pages/browse/pages